'Curious 7-year-old Lily sees the world through a fantasy story written by one of her two fathers. When a strange woman arrives from one of her fathers’ past, Lily looks to the story of the Pebble Moon to understand what true family means.'
'A film where we see the world as it appears to a seven year old girl, and her retreat to fantasy when her family is under threat. The film uses a form of magical realism very well, leaving reality simply implied to the audience. It's very well written, has great emotional resonance - heartstrings were tugged - and I was very much impressed' - @beer_mat_movies
'One of the pleasant surprises of the festival, this little gem had gone completely under our radar and turned out to be something quite special. A touching account from a child’s perspective living with two fathers, it eschews ‘preaching’ and becomes something different from your usual ‘issues’ film. The naturalistic dialogue and fantastic performance from the young leading lady Darcie Russell made this stand out from the crowd.' - strangersinacinema.com
